Solder Alloy 111 vs. C87610 Bronze

Solder alloy 111 belongs to the otherwise unclassified metals classification, while C87610 bronze belongs to the copper alloys. There are 23 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(6,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is solder alloy 111 and the bottom bar is C87610 bronze.
